Another problem I can't solve
A box of mass 6kg lies on a rough plane inclined at an angle of 30 to the horizontal. The box is held in equilibrium by means of a horizontal force of magnitude P Newtons.
The coefficent of friction between the box and the plane is 0.4.
Find the normal reaction exerted on the body by the plane.
The box is in limiting equilibrium and on the point of moving up the plane.
